Culinary Guide

Food in Kāmepalle

Kāmepalle’s cuisine blends Telugu influence with Deccan pantry staples: rice-based dishes, lentils, fresh vegetables, and seasonal flavors. Meals are often communal, hearty, and prepared with locally sourced produce.

Kāmepalle Famous Food

Signature dishes, delicacies and famous food

Pesarattu

Green gram crepe often served with ginger chutney; a staple breakfast item in the region.

Must-Try!

Gutti Vankaya

Eggplant stuffed with a spiced peanut-tamarind mixture, usually served with rice or roti.

Pulihora

Tamarind rice tempered with curry leaves, peanuts, and mustard seeds for a tangy, flavorful dish.

Pachi Pulusu

Tangy tamarind curry, traditionally prepared with fish but adaptable to vegetables; popular near riverine areas.

Climate Guide

Weather

The climate is tropical savanna with distinct wet and dry seasons. Summers are hot, monsoons bring rain and green landscapes, and winters are cooler but mild. Light layering is useful year-round.

How to Behave

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ior

Modest Dress

Dress modestly, especially when visiting temples and traditional homes; shoulders and knees covered.

Shoes Off

Remove shoes before entering homes and many religious sites.

Photography Consent

Ask before photographing people or private spaces; be respectful if declined.

Best Time to Visit

And what to expect in different seasons...

Summer

Hot and dry; carry water, sunscreen, and a hat. Plan outdoor activities for early morning and late afternoon.

Monsoon

Lush, green landscapes with intermittent heavy rains. Muddy paths and slick surfaces; carry a rain poncho and waterproof footwear.

Winter

Mild days with cooler nights; a light jacket is enough for evenings and early mornings; ideal for outdoor explorations.
